There were calls to cancel the fireworks due to the extreme bushfires across the country , with a petition proposing for their budget to be reallocated to disaster relief purposes. The fires had prompted cancellations and postponements of fireworks celebrations in other areas.
Fireworks director Fortunato Foti was to also be consulted in the event of high winds. The Rural Fire Service, which granted an exemption to the fire ban for the show, stated that it did not expect "catastrophic" conditions to return on New Year's Eve. Sydney officials stated that it would be infeasible to cancel the show, as it would be disruptive to tourists and local business, much of the budget had already been spent, and that there would be "little practical benefit for affected communities".
Goldberg explained that "the one thing that will help those communities is to go ahead with the event and leverage the power of it to drive people to donate". Due to the COVID pandemic in Australia , the —21 edition was scaled back to consist only of a shortened, seven-minute fireworks display at midnight, with the Family Fireworks placed on hiatus. A two-stage perimeter was established within Sydney's central business district CBD , Circular Quay , and North Sydney on the evening of the event, with the "yellow zone" being patrolled by police to break up large crowds that violate NSW health orders in regards to gatherings, [26] [27] [28] and the "green zone" in closer proximity to the harbour having restricted access by permit only after p.
Permits were only granted to local residents, those who had a confirmed reservation at a hospitality business within a green zone such as a restaurant or hotel , and employees of businesses within the zone. To honour their involvement, plans were announced for certain "premium" viewing areas on the foreshore to be reserved exclusively to invited frontline workers.
Premier Berejiklian scrapped the plan on 28 December amid new cases of community transmission in Greater Sydney which had prompted a localised stay at home order for Sydney's Northern Beaches , and a tightening of restrictions on gatherings elsewhere , stating that there was "too much of a health risk having people from the regions and from Sydney and from broader regional areas congregate all in the CBD".
She said that the state government would "find another opportunity during the year to recognise what [they] have done". Made of rope light attached to a panel and truss system, the display showcased a variety of symbols and other images related to the current year's theme. In recent times, the bridge has included a rope light display on a framework in the centre of the eastern arch, which is used to complement the fireworks. As the scaffolding and framework are clearly visible for some weeks before the event, revealing the outline of the design, there is much speculation as to how the effect is to be realised.
The bridge effect has been designed by Brian Thomson since , with the lighting designed by Mark Hammer since Since , the current lighting designer is Ziggy Ziegler. A continual stream of fireworks falling from the base of the bridge down to actually touch the water.
The waterfall comprises approximately 1, candle fireworks. Each year, it has been a traditional golden waterfall. Some years the waterfall effect has been changed such as on NYE when the waterfall changed colours from gold to silver. NYE was also unique in that fireworks were also fired for the first time from the gantry of the bridge. NYE had a " strobing angelic " waterfall effect where Roman candles released mines and stars that " twinkled ". This effect was repeated on NYE where it changed colour from red to white and also on NYE where it was coloured only green.
NYE had the traditional golden waterfall effect except that it slowed crossed the bridge from south to north. This was a difficult set up due to the arch's access but a first of its kind on the bridge with a spectacular "torrent style" waterfall effect. On NYE , a rainbow waterfall cascaded from the harbour bridge during the midnight show, celebrating the legalisation of same-sex marriage in Australia.
The golden waterfall was to be used again on NYE , however, it failed to ignite as programmed.
